Description

  • Manage day-to-day on-site construction activities from groundbreaking to project completion
  • Drive project schedules to ensure timely delivery while maintaining high quality standards
  • Oversee subcontractors, vendors, and field staff to ensure alignment with project goals
  • Enforce safety protocols and maintain a clean, secure job site in compliance with OSHA standards
  • Coordinate closely with project managers, engineers, and ownership teams to ensure seamless communication and execution
  • Inspect work regularly to ensure adherence to plans, specs, and quality standards
  • Resolve on-site issues quickly to keep the project moving forward
  • Lead site meetings and create daily reports to track project progress and address concerns
